Gigi truly offers the best of both worlds! Just under two years old, Gigi is an absolute beauty with her soft grey coat and expressive eyes. She may be a little shy when settling into a new environment, which is perfectly normal, but once she feels safe, her sweet and gentle personality really shines. When Gigi is in the mood for cuddles, she’ll happily stay close by, often right at your feet. When she needs a bit of quiet time, she won’t go far - just to her favourite cozy spot where she can relax and recharge. While she may not immediately seek out your lap, she’s comfortable being picked up and handled, and she genuinely enjoys affection. Gigi is a playful girl and loves wand toys and batting around little balls. When playtime is over, you’ll often find her curled up in her favourite comfy bed for a well-earned nap. Gigi isn’t fussy with her meals - she’s quite happy with Fancy Feast in gravy, though she does have refined taste when it comes to treats. Churu is her clear favourite, and she’ll choose it over Temptations every time. Gigi is comfortable sharing space with other cats, although she tends to keep to herself rather than engaging in play and seems to prefer male cats over females. She does well with children, but her experience with dogs is unknown. She would also be content as a single cat in a home where someone is around often, to keep her company.<br/><br/>Gigi came to us as an owner surrender through no fault of her own when her previous family was no longer able to provide the care she deserved.<br/><br/>Gigi is finally ready for her forever home at last, where she’ll be loved, given the affection she craves, and respected when she needs her quiet moments. Home at Last Rescue's Adoption Policy
Completed adoption applications are reviewed by an adoption coordinator and foster home. If suitable for cat/kitten, they will be contacted for a phone interview. A vet check is also done. If interview and vet check are satisfactory, a meet & greet (either virtual or in person, at discretion of foster) with foster home and cat is arranged. If is it determined to be a suitable match for both the adopter and cat, adoption is approved. Payments and contract are completed virtually and pickup is arranged.
